At Jaffe, Hanle. Whisonant & Knight, P.C., our criminal defense attorneys know the stakes for those facing white collar crime charges. Using deception and fraud for financial gain can affect entire companies or municipal areas along with those who depend on them. Because of this wide-reaching impact, prosecutors pursue these cases aggressively. Charges involving more than $2,500 worth of property or records are considered Class B felonies in Alabama, punishable by up to 20 years in prison plus fines and restitution. Those accused often face federal charges as well, which can mean fines of up to $250,000 along with jail time.
